Full time (36.5hours) permanent position.
The School of Engineering is seeking a proactive and organised Administrative Assistant to join our Staff Administration Team.
This role is extremely varied with no two days being the same. Being based within a small team, it offers you the opportunity to work on activities and processes independently, and autonomously from start to finish. You will take ownership of key administrative processes, with a particular focus on recruitment and HR support. This involves managing end-to-end recruitment processes for both permanent and temporary staff, acting as a key liaison for hiring managers, HR teams, and candidates.
In addition, you will provide high-quality administrative support to senior colleague, including the School's Research Cluster Leads and Directors of Teaching. This includes servicing Committees, taking minutes, coordinating and attending meetings as well as supporting key academic events.
This role is based in our Staff Administration Team within the School of Engineering on the University's campus in Coventry. Whilst we currently offer hybrid-working arrangements, the successful candidate will be expected to work a minimum of the first three months of their appointment onsite full time. After this, due to the nature of this role, it is expected that the post holder will be required to work on campus a minimum of 80% of their time on a team rota. Additional days in the office may be required at busy times, or to cover colleague absence.

The School of Engineering is committed to the principles of the Athena SWAN Charter, which recognises work undertaken to address gender equality, representation and progression for all staff working in an academic environment. The School currently holds the Athena SWAN Gold award and the University holds an Institutional Silver award.
